We use arcminute-scale data from the Sunyaev-Zel'dovich Infrared Experimentto set limits on anisotropies in the cosmic microwave background radiation inopen and spatially-flat-Lambda cold dark matter cosmogonies. There are no2-sigma detections for the models tested. The upper limits obtained areconsistent with the amplitude of anisotropy detected by the COBE/DMRexperiment.Comment: 17 pages including 4 postscript figures. Latex. Uses aaspp4. ApJ, in pres
